原初暴胀期间非定域引力的稳定性问题

摘要
我们研究了当初始条件设定在原初暴胀阶段时,某些非定域引力模型的宇宙学演化。我们特别考察了先前由我们小组引入的三个模型,即所谓的 RT、RR 和 模型。我们发现 RR 和 模型在暴胀期间也具有稳定的演化。RT 模型存在表观不稳定性,但我们证明,由于非定域项相关的尺度与暴胀尺度相比很小,这种不稳定性是无害的,并且即使其初始条件设定在原初暴胀阶段,RT 模型也具有可行的演化。
